Lawrenceville PD working through problems after ransomware attack

By AccessWDUN Staff

The Lawrenceville Police Department has had to work without access to computer records this week following a ransom ware attack on the department's computer system.

Lt. Jake Parker told CBS 46 in Atlanta officials believe the department was a specific target of the hackers.

Parker told the television station officers started to notice problems last weekend and the intrusion was confirmed Monday. Email has remained offline all week, and officers have had to radio reports in rather than file them electronically from their patrol cars. Reports are being written by hand.

Parker said records are routinely backed up, but he was unsure when the last back-up occurred, so there's no way to know how may records have been lost.

The TV station said city officials right now are trying to determine if they'll pay the ransom demanded by the hackers or if they'll try to completely rebuild the computer system for the police department.
